swift5にてSqlite3とFMDBライブラリ利用で、iPhoneアプリ内にデータベース構築し、アプリ個別情報管理に利用する。
https://www.sqlite.org/download.html
より(2022/03)現在最新sqlite-tools-osx-x86-3380100をダウンロード。
sqlite3をXcode内へコピー
FMDBの導入は下記サイトよりダウンロード。
https://github.com/ccgus/fmdb
フォルダsrc→fmdbフォルダ内の下記ファイル群を
Xcode内にgroupフォルダfmdbを作成その内にコピーと同時にheaderファイル作成要求に従い作成そのファイルXXXXXXXXXXX-Bridging-Header.h内に下記のように記述。
#import "FMDatabase.h"
#import "FMResultSet.h"
#import "FMDatabaseAdditions.h"
#import "FMDatabaseQueue.h"
#import "FMDatabasePool.h"
#import "sqlite3.h"
これにてプロジェクト内で任意のデータベースを作成利用可能となる。
More than 3 years have passed since last update.
Register as a new user and use Qiita more conveniently
- You get articles that match your needs
- You can efficiently read back useful information
- You can use dark theme